Hello Mr. Freeman. I hope you enjoy the review

This game won more game of the year awards than I can count, and for good reason too; the game is great. It is a truly inept first person experience due to the unique characters and their detailed facial expressions, the suspenseful,scary, and intense action, the atmosphere that makes you feel exactly like the folks at Valve wanted-everything has polish, and detail . There isn't anything mind blowingly innovating about the game, but everything it sets out to do is done fantastically. I was very captivated by the story, and loved the physics. I came for the FPSness, and stayed for one of the best PC games I've ever played.
